Second year film student Lysah Kenny sent this cool light painting stop motion film my way. They asked 200 people around the world a simple question “What is Life” and then animated the answers using light painting photography.
Every frame in this film was hand-drawn with lights & torches, and captured using long-exposure photography.
A three-word question with infinite possibilities…
“What Is Life?” presents a collection of individual responses from a variety of people around the world.
The universal, the unique, the good and the bad, all visually represented by hand-animated light.
Created by students at MAPS Film School in South Australia.
